Understanding the Flexibility of a Fillet Knife
The flexibility of a fillet knife is a critical factor that influences its effectiveness in filleting fish. Flexibility refers to the ability of the knife's blade to bend or flex during use, which is essential for making precise cuts that follow the contours of the fish's bones and skin. Here's a closer look at why flexibility matters and how to choose the right level of flex for your needs.
Why Flexibility is Important
- Precision Cutting: A flexible blade can more easily glide along the spine and ribs of the fish, minimizing waste and ensuring you get the most meat possible.
- Ease of Use: A knife that flexes appropriately for the fish size and thickness can make the filleting process smoother and less strenuous.
- Adaptability: Different levels of flexibility are better suited for different sizes and types of fish. More flexibility is typically needed for smaller, thinner fish, while less is better for larger, thicker fish.
Types of Flexibility
Stiff Flex
- Best for: Large, thick-skinned fish like tuna or salmon.
- Characteristics: Offers more control and strength, allowing for clean cuts through dense and large fish without bending too much, which could make precise cuts difficult.
Medium Flex
- Best for: Medium-sized fish like bass or walleye.
- Characteristics: Strikes a balance between stiffness and flexibility, making it versatile for various types of fish and providing enough give to maneuver around bones.
Light Flex
- Best for: Smaller, more delicate fish like trout and panfish.
- Characteristics: Highly flexible, ideal for making intricate cuts and working closely along the bones, ensuring minimal meat is left on the skeleton.
Choosing the Right Flex
Selecting the right level of flexibility depends largely on the type of fish you commonly prepare and your personal preference for knife handling. Consider the following when choosing:
- Type of Fish: The size and thickness of the fish should guide your choice. Larger, thicker fish will require a stiffer blade, while smaller, more delicate fish benefit from a more flexible blade.
- Personal Comfort and Skill Level: Some anglers or cooks prefer a stiffer or more flexible blade based on their filleting technique and comfort level.
- Quality of the Knife: High-quality materials and construction can enhance the performance of a fillet knife, regardless of its flexibility. Look for knives that balance flexibility with durability and sharpness.
Materials Matter
When choosing a fillet knife, the materials used in both the blade and the handle are crucial for performance, durability, and comfort. Here's a breakdown of the key materials to consider for the blade and handle of a fillet knife:
Blade Materials
- Stainless Steel: The most common material for fillet knives due to its resistance to rust and corrosion. It maintains a sharp edge and is generally easy to care for, making it ideal for use in wet conditions typical in fishing and kitchen environments. Look for high-carbon stainless steel options like 440C or VG-10 for enhanced strength and edge retention.
- High Carbon Steel: Known for its hardness and ability to maintain a sharp edge longer, high carbon steel is preferred by many for its cutting precision. However, it is more prone to rusting if not properly cared for, requiring regular maintenance to keep it in good condition.
- Ceramic: While not as common, ceramic blades are extremely sharp and hold their edge for a long time. They are also rust-proof and easy to clean. The downside is their brittleness; ceramic knives can chip or break if dropped or used improperly.
Handle Materials
- Wood: Wood handles offer a classic look and can provide a comfortable, warm grip. However, they require more maintenance to keep them from warping or rotting, especially when exposed to moisture frequently.
- Rubber: Rubber handles provide excellent grip, even in wet conditions, making them a popular choice for fillet knives used on boats or in wet kitchens. They are durable and comfortable but can sometimes be difficult to clean if the surface is very textured.
- Plastic: A common choice for fillet knives due to its durability and ease of maintenance. High-quality plastics can offer good grip and are resistant to moisture, chemicals, and changes in temperature.
- Composite: Materials such as G-10 (a type of fiberglass laminate) or Micarta (layers of cloth or paper bonded with resin) provide excellent durability and grip. These materials are resistant to water, making them suitable for fillet knives that require frequent cleaning and exposure to wet conditions.
- Polypropylene: This thermoplastic polymer is often used for knife handles because it's tough, resistant to bending, and withstands corrosion and chemicals. It's also lightweight, making it easy to handle for extended periods.
Full Tang vs. Partial Tang: Assessing Knife Strength and Durability
When choosing a fillet knife, one of the key considerations is the tang, or how the blade's metal extends into the knife handle. The design of the tang can significantly affect the overall strength, balance, and durability of the knife. There are primarily two types of tangs in knives: full tang and partial tang. Here's what you need to know about each to make an informed decision.
Full Tang Knives
- Description: In a full tang design, the metal of the blade extends the full length and width of the handle, often visible as a metal spine running through the handle's center.
- Strength and Durability: This design provides maximum strength and durability. The weight and balance of a full tang knife are evenly distributed, which can offer better control and leverage when filleting larger or tougher fish.
- Typical Use: Full tang knives are preferred for their robustness in demanding tasks. They are particularly valued in professional settings or by those who frequently prepare large, tough fish.
- Advantages: Enhances the knife's lifespan and stability during use. It's less likely to break or bend because the handle and blade are essentially a single piece.
Partial Tang Knives
- Description: Partial tang designs can vary; some extend the full length of the handle but only part of its width, while others might not extend the full length. Common types include stick tangs and rat-tail tangs, which taper as they go into the handle.
- Strength and Durability: While offering sufficient strength for many tasks, partial tangs are generally not as durable or balanced as full tang knives. They may be prone to breaking at the joint where the blade and handle meet, especially under heavy use.
- Typical Use: These knives can be lighter, which some may find more comfortable for less intensive tasks or smaller fish. They are often more affordable and sufficient for casual use or by those who do not frequently fillet tough or large fish.
- Advantages: Partial tang knives are typically lighter and can reduce fatigue during prolonged use. They are also usually less expensive while still providing good functionality for many applications.
